What the Experts Say
Body language can speak louder than words, and expert analysis reveals that gestures, postures, and facial expressions convey significant information. According to experts, the dynamics between Herbert and Beer exhibit a complex interplay of signals, indicating more than just a casual acquaintance. While some fans might read into their interactions as romantic, the expert suggests a more nuanced interpretation might be in order.
For instance, small gestures such as leaning in during conversations, maintaining eye contact, and mirroring each other's movements can indicate comfort and familiarity. However, these behaviors are not strictly reserved for romantic relationships; they can also reflect friendship and camaraderie. Thus, separating platonic relationships from romantic interests requires careful consideration of context.
Decoding Contextual Signals
Context is pivotal when interpreting body language. The camp setting itself plays a significant role in shaping interactions. Both Herbert and Beer were engaged in a relaxed environment, which may have encouraged playful behavior that does not necessarily translate to deeper feelings. Camp activities may foster a spirit of collaboration and fun, leading to more animated interactions that are typical among friends rather than prospective partners.
The expert emphasizes the importance of recognizing the constraints of social media when analyzing body language. Short clips may lack the full context of a conversation, leaving room for misinterpretation. A moment captured without understanding the surrounding events can lead to skewed perceptions, a common pitfall in our digital age.
